Call to scrap Batu Caves condo project

DAP national chairman Karpal Singh wants the Selangor Government to scrap the controversial 29-storey condominium project near Batu Caves.

He also called for an end to the blame game whether it was the Barisan Nasional or Pakatan Rakyat state government which was responsible for approving the project.

Karpal (DAP – Bukit Gelugor) said he fully supported Batu Caves temple committee chairman Datuk R. Nadarajah’s warning that the matter would be taken to court if the project was not scrapped within a month.

“In the event the matter is taken to court, I will offer my services pro bono to ensure a judicial pronouncement in favour of the temple committee,” he said in a statement issued at the Parliament lobby.

It was reported that Batu Caves would face the risk of caving in if the condominium project were to proceed.

Karpal said the limestone formation in Batu Caves was a priceless asset that should be preserved.

“A world renowned heritage should not be allowed to be sacrificed at the convenience of material development,” he said.
